4 Canvey Street
According to our databases, most users of this restaurant (Leamside) live within 87KM.
45 Moscow Road
List your lived experience in this restaurant (Leamside) for other users to see.
Heron Tower
110 Bishopsgate
According to our databases, most users of this restaurant (Leamside) live within 63KM.
167 Piccadilly
According to our information many users of this restaurant (Leamside) are citizens of Leamside.
17B Strutton Ground
According to our databases, most users of this restaurant (Leamside) live within 87KM.
75 Parkway
List your lived experience in this restaurant (Leamside) for other users to see.
11 Henrietta Street
Covent Garden
This restaurant is located in 11 Henrietta Street
Covent Garden, in the city of Leamside.
3a Camden Wharf
Canal front Camden Lock
This restaurant is recommended by our users.
38 Clarges Street
According to our databases, most users of this restaurant (Leamside) live within 63KM.
37 Tottenham Court Road
According to our information many users of this restaurant (Leamside) are citizens of Leamside.
14 North End Rd
Golders Green
According to our databases, most users of this restaurant (Leamside) live within 87KM.